Shop Local, Develop Local: A Business Australia Emphasis

The increasing tide of consumer awareness in Australia is prompting a significant shift towards supporting community businesses. This "Shop Local, Cultivate Local" movement isn’t merely a fad; it's a fundamental re-evaluation of how we allocate our money and its effect on the Australian economy. Small and local enterprises, the backbone of many regional communities, often encounter to compete with larger, overseas corporations. Choosing to patronise businesses within your local area provides a direct injection of capital that energizes job creation, enhances community infrastructure, and preserves the unique character of our towns and cities. Furthermore, obtaining products and services locally often means a lesser environmental footprint due to fewer transportation distances. Ultimately, embracing this philosophy fosters a stronger resilient and sustainable Australia for all Australians.

Supporting Australian Regions

Across this land, local businesses play a crucial role in far more than just providing products; they are the cornerstones of community life. These small enterprises foster a atmosphere of belonging, creating gathering places and opportunities that larger chains often can't offer. They support local sports teams, contribute to charities, and build connections with their clients that transcend simple transactions. Choosing local and keeps money circulating within the local economy, creating jobs and bolstering regional growth, but it also preserves the unique character and charm of each city. It's about much more than just buying something; it’s about supporting in the future of your neighbourhood and the health of those around you.
